R/GA Accelerator provides an immersive, mentor-driven program for early-stage startups. It focuses on developing innovative products and services in verticals like connected commerce and IoT. The accelerator leverages R/GA’s expertise in design, technology, and brand strategy, enabling participants to build intelligent systems for market entry and scaling.
R/GA, established by Bob Greenberg, launched its accelerator programs via R/GA Ventures to expand its innovation model. This initiative stemmed from the insight that nurturing emerging companies integrates agile startup methodologies with R/GA’s strategic and creative capabilities. The firm creates value by guiding new ventures, broadening its technological influence.
The program serves early-stage technology companies seeking structured growth and strategic connections. Participants access industry knowledge, mentorship, and resources to refine their business models and offerings. R/GA Accelerator aims to cultivate groundbreaking ventures that will advance various sectors, driving new ideas and fostering long-term innovation.
R/GA Accelerator is part of R/GA Ventures, an investment and innovation arm of R/GA, a global creative agency. It operates as a venture accelerator and studio that invests in startups, primarily those developing technology-driven products and services that align with R/GA’s client needs and market trends. The accelerator focuses on strategic growth through product incubation, intellectual property development, and partnerships, serving startups up to Series B stage by connecting them with R/GA’s extensive network of global brand clients and industry leaders. Its mission is to unlock value through partnership, investment, and IP development, supporting nearly 200 companies with financial capital, agency services, and commercial facilitation[1][2][6].
Founded in 2013 by Stephen Plumlee and R/GA CEO Robert Greenberg, R/GA Ventures evolved from an initial incubator concept into a hybrid accelerator model leveraging R/GA’s global digital talent and A-list client roster. Early programs included joint accelerators with partners like the Los Angeles Dodgers and retail chains such as Westfield, focusing on solving specific client problems by selecting cohorts of startups with complementary approaches. This model has since expanded into sector-focused venture studios, including sports innovation and connected commerce, reflecting a strategic evolution from pure acceleration to a blend of incubation, investment, and co-development[2][3][4].
R/GA Accelerator rides the trend of corporate venture innovation, where established brands collaborate with startups to accelerate digital transformation and create new business models. The timing is critical as industries face rapid disruption from AI, connected commerce, and sports technology innovations. R/GA’s approach of combining agency creativity with venture capital and client partnerships positions it uniquely to influence how startups scale and integrate into larger ecosystems. This model supports the broader ecosystem by bridging the gap between startup agility and corporate resources, fostering innovation that benefits both[1][2][4].
